Key Features to Consider in Toro Mulchers
When shopping Toro mulchers, prioritize these standout attributes:
- Air Speed and Volume: The 51619 model blasts at 250 mph with up to 340 CFM, shredding leaves at a 16:1 ratio for compact storage.
- Versatility: Switch seamlessly between blowing, vacuuming, and mulching modes with included attachments like the metal impeller guard.
- Build Quality: Rugged plastic housings with metal components ensure longevity, backed by Toro's reliable engineering.
- Ease of Use: Lightweight at around 10 lbs, with cord lock and intuitive controls for all-day comfort.
- Oscillating Nozzle: Covers wide areas quickly without constant repositioning.

Is the Toro 51619 Ultra suitable for wet leaves?
Yes, its metal impeller and high air speed handle wet leaves effectively, mulching them into fine pieces without frequent unclogging—ideal for rainy fall cleanups.
